The length of the rectangle is 12 cm, the width is 4 cm less. Find the area of the rectangle. Calculate its perimeter.

The width of the rectangle is 4 cm less than its length, which is 12 cm, which is:

12 – 4 = 8 cm.

The perimeter (the sum of all sides) is calculated using the formula:

P = 2a + 2b = 2 * 12 + 2 * 8 = 24 + 16 = 40 cm.

The area of such a figure, the opposite dimensions of which are equal, corresponds to:

S = a * b = 12 * 8 = 96 cm².
